Re: Barnett not willing to die?
Bishops strengths are the kind that fans like myself love. He is known for his hard hitting and aggressive play. It is great to watch, but I worry more about Bishops weaknesses, namely getting completely lost on a play and costing your team a TD.
If he gets his chance, I just hope he's more comfortable with the D and and doesn't negate his strengths with his weaknesses.
